From c195b4ebc79b60539083f7089a5f878c1604fce9 Mon Sep 17 00:00:00 2001
From: xyh <18782104331@139.com>
Date: 星期三, 30 六月 2021 18:05:11 +0800
Subject: [PATCH] Merge remote-tracking branch 'origin/test' into test

---
 springcloud_k8s_panzhihuazhihuishequ/common/src/main/java/com/panzhihua/common/service/community/CommunityService.java |   63 +++++++++++++++++++++++++++++++
 1 files changed, 62 insertions(+), 1 deletions(-)

diff --git a/springcloud_k8s_panzhihuazhihuishequ/common/src/main/java/com/panzhihua/common/service/community/CommunityService.java b/springcloud_k8s_panzhihuazhihuishequ/common/src/main/java/com/panzhihua/common/service/community/CommunityService.java
index ed76c8b..c449e01 100644
--- a/springcloud_k8s_panzhihuazhihuishequ/common/src/main/java/com/panzhihua/common/service/community/CommunityService.java
+++ b/springcloud_k8s_panzhihuazhihuishequ/common/src/main/java/com/panzhihua/common/service/community/CommunityService.java
@@ -19,7 +19,7 @@
 import com.panzhihua.common.model.dtos.elders.ComEldersAuthGetResultDTO;
 import com.panzhihua.common.model.dtos.elders.ComEldersAuthPageDTO;
 import com.panzhihua.common.model.dtos.elders.ComEldersAuthUserAddAppDTO;
-import com.panzhihua.common.model.dtos.grid.PagePopulationListDTO;
+import com.panzhihua.common.model.dtos.grid.*;
 import com.panzhihua.common.model.dtos.grid.admin.ComMngPopulationListDTO;
 import com.panzhihua.common.model.dtos.neighbor.*;
 import com.panzhihua.common.model.dtos.neighbor.*;
@@ -3159,6 +3159,67 @@
     @PostMapping("/population/grid/del")
     R delGridPopulation(@RequestBody List<Long> ids);
 
+    /**
+     * 综治后台-居民详情
+     * @param populationId  居民id
+     * @return  居民详情
+     */
     @GetMapping("/population/grid/get")
     R getGridPopulationDetail(@RequestParam("populationId")Long populationId);
+
+    /**
+     * 综治app-小区列表
+     * @param villageListAppDTO 请求参数
+     * @return  小区列表
+     */
+    @PostMapping("/village/grid/list")
+    R getGridVillageList(@RequestBody ComMngVillageListAppDTO villageListAppDTO);
+
+    /**
+     * 综治app-根据小区id查询小区下楼栋列表
+     * @param villageId 小区id
+     * @return  楼栋列表
+     */
+    @PostMapping("/village/grid/building/list")
+    R getGridVillageBuildingList(@RequestParam("villageId")Long villageId);
+
+    /**
+     * 小区楼栋下房屋列表
+     * @param buildHouseAppDTO  请求参数
+     * @return  房屋列表
+     */
+    @PostMapping("/village/grid/building/house/list")
+    R getGridVillageBuildingHouseList(@RequestBody PageComMngVillageBuildHouseAppDTO buildHouseAppDTO);
+
+    /**
+     * 小区楼栋下房屋信息
+     * @param houseId   房屋id
+     * @return  房屋信息
+     */
+    @PostMapping("/village/grid/building/house/detail")
+    R getGridVillageBuildingHouseDetail(@RequestParam("houseId")Long houseId);
+
+    /**
+     * 查询平台人口列表
+     * @param populationDTO 请求参数
+     * @return  人口列表
+     */
+    @PostMapping("/village/grid/building/house/population/list")
+    R getBuildingHousePopulationList(@RequestBody PageComMngPopulationDTO populationDTO);
+
+    /**
+     * 批量向房屋新增人员
+     * @param housePopulationDTO    请求参数
+     * @return  添加结果
+     */
+    @PostMapping("/village/grid/building/house/add/population")
+    R addBuildingHousePopulation(@RequestBody AddComMngHousePopulationDTO housePopulationDTO);
+
+    /**
+     * 批量删除房屋内人员
+     * @param housePopulationDTO    请求参数
+     * @return  删除结果
+     */
+    @PostMapping("/village/grid/building/house/del/population")
+    R delBuildingHousePopulation(@RequestBody DelComMngHousePopulationDTO housePopulationDTO);
 }

--
Gitblit v1.7.1